United States, California, Inyo County, Kearsarge Pass
36.7727 -118.3766 +-5m.
3585 meters (11759ft)
alpine granite ridge
granite pebble
thallus lacking; medulla I- or I+ red throughout; apothecia clustered along cracks; epihymenium bright aeruginose; hymenium ~50um, bluish-greenish; hypothecium dark brown on top and in a distinct layer below, paler between; exciple thick, dark red-brown outside, distinctly reddish inside appearing C+pink, K~ violet where reddish, tips of hyphae swollen to ~8um and distinctly greenish, interior hyphae very thin < 2.5um (best seen in K squash); spores 8 per ascus, oblong-ellipsoid, ~9-12x3um; TLC confluentic + unknown (JPH plate 51.4 solvents B' and C on 20180501)
